BRIDGEPORT TO REOPEN TUESDAY GAS-LINE LEAK FOUND 4 FEET UNDERGROUND.


Byline: Patricia Farrell Aidem Staff Writer

VALENCIA - Gas Company workers are replacing connections on a gas line under the 2 1/2-year-old Bridgeport Elementary School elementary school: see school.  in Valencia, closed much of this week because of a chronic leak.

The work is expected to be completed today and school will resume Tuesday - Monday is a holiday celebrating Martin Luther King Jr.'s birthday.

``We didn't have heat, but fortunately, Wednesday was relatively warm,'' Fish said.

An emergency school board meeting was called Wednesday night and the board agreed to shut down the school for two days so all the connections - damaged or not - could be replaced and the lines further tested.

The cause of the leaks is being investigated, but the timing indicates the damage could have been caused by the storm, she said.
